PROFESSIONAL RELATIONSHIPS AND PROFESSIONAL VALUES
PROFESSIONAL KNOWLEDGE IN PRACTICE
____________________________________________________________________
|
Fully certificated teachers engage in appropriate professional relationships and demonstrate commitment to professional values.
i. engage in ethical, respectful, positive and collaborative professional relationships with: • ākonga • teaching colleagues, support staff and other professionals • whānau and other carers of ākonga • agencies, groups and individuals in the community. Reflective Question: What do I do to establish working relationships with my ākonga, their whānau and my colleagues and others to support the learning of those I teach? ______________________________________________________________________ i. take all reasonable steps to provide and maintain a teaching and learning environment that is physically, socially, culturally and emotionally safe ii. acknowledge and respect the languages, heritages and cultures of all ākonga iii. comply with relevant regulatory and statutory requirements. Reflective Question: How do I show that I actively promote the well-being of all ākonga for whom I am responsible in my practice? ______________________________________________________________________
i. demonstrate respect for the heritages, languages and cultures of both partners to the Treaty of Waitangi. Reflective Question: How do I reflect in my professional work respect for the cultural heritages of both Treaty of Waitangi partners in Aotearoa New Zealand? ______________________________________________________________________
i. identify professional learning goals in consultation with colleagues ii. participate responsively in professional learning opportunities within the learning community iii initiate learning opportunities to advance personal professional knowledge and skills. Reflective Question: How do I continue to advance my professional learning as a teacher? ______________________________________________________________________ i. actively contribute to the professional learning community ii undertake areas of responsibility effectively. Reflective Question: How do I help support my colleagues to strengthen teaching and learning in my setting? ______________________________________________________________________ Fully certificated teachers make use of their professional knowledge and understanding to build a stimulating, challenging and supportive learning environment that promotes learning and success for all ākonga. i. articulate clearly the aims of their teaching, give sound professional reasons for adopting these aims and implement them in their practice ii. through their planning and teaching, demonstrate their knowledge and understanding of relevant content, disciplines and curriculum documents. Reflective Question: What do I take into account when planning programmes of work for groups and individuals? ______________________________________________________________________ i. demonstrate effective management of the learning setting that incorporates successful strategies to engage and motivate ākonga. ii. foster trust, respect and co-operation with and among ākonga. Reflective Question: How does my teaching practice promote an environment where learners feel safe to explore ideas and respond respectfully to others in the group? ______________________________________________________________________ i. enable ākonga to make connections between their prior experiences and learning and their current learning activities ii. provide opportunities and support for ākonga to engage with, practise and apply new learning to different contexts iii. encourage ākonga to take responsibility for their own learning and behaviour iv. assist ākonga to think critically about information and ideas and to reflect on their learning. Reflective Question: How does my teaching reflect my understanding of the main influences on how my ākonga learn? ______________________________________________________________________
i. demonstrate knowledge and understanding of social and cultural influences on learning, by working effectively in the bicultural and multi-cultural contexts of learning in Aotearoa New Zealand
ii. select teaching approaches, resources, technologies and learning and assessment activities that are inclusive and effective for diverse ākonga. iii. modify teaching approaches to address the needs of individuals and groups of ākonga. Reflective Question: How does my knowledge of the varied strengths, interests and needs of individuals and groups of ākonga influence how I teach them? ______________________________________________________________________
i. practise and develop the relevant use of te reo Māori me ngā tikanga-ā-iwi in context ii. specifically and effectively address the educational aspirations of ākonga Māori, displaying high expectations for their learning. Reflective Question: In my teaching, how do I take into account the bicultural context of teaching and learning in Aotearoa New Zealand? ______________________________________________________________________ i. analyse assessment information to identify progress and ongoing learning needs of ākonga ii. use assessment information to give regular and ongoing feedback to guide and support further learning iii. analyse assessment information to reflect on and evaluate the effectiveness of the teaching iv. communicate assessment and achievement information to relevant members of the learning community v. foster involvement of whānau in the collection and use of information about the learning of ākonga. Reflective Question: How do I gather and use assessment information in ways that advance the learning of my ākonga? ______________________________________________________________________ i. systematically and critically engage with evidence and professional literature to reflect on and refine practice
ii. respond professionally to feedback from members of their learning community
iii. critically examine their own beliefs, including cultural beliefs, and how they impact on their professional practice and the achievement of ākonga.
Reflective Question: How do I advance the learning of my ākonga through critical inquiry within my professional learning? |
